Why do users share content on Facebook ? How to exploit the appropriate psychological levers to make your content viral and encourage its propagation on social media? In a previous post , I indicated the 5 most important reasons that push users to share content on social media: Timeliness Emotion The visual impact Belonging to communities Idealization These points must be kept in mind every time you think about producing content. OPTIMIZE CONTENT FOR EACH SOCIAL MEDIA There are some steps you can apply in general: Make share buttons clearly visible : On your page or blog, add share buttons at the top and bottom of the page. Make sure everything works, even on mobile.
Write a title that is worthy of sharing : Give your content an interesting, curious, engaging title. It is one of the fundamental success factors in your sharing goal. In different A/B tests carried out in different studies, the traffic generated by a piece of content with a terrible title or with an optimized title can vary by +500%. The title is very important, and you don't have to write the first thing that comes to mind. Read how to optimize your title on the web . Explicitly invite people to share : don't underestimate the value that the simple request to share your content can have: "Share on Facebook". Use Open Meta Tags : make sure your web pages have the correct Open Meta Tags in the html code. They serve to establish exactly what will appear as an image, title and subtitle when a social media site shares it. Make sure there is always a relevant, well-sized image.
